Russia-Ukraine: Moscow uses hypersonic missiles

Kremlin confirmation; for the U.S. this weapon will not change the conflict

Russia confirmed the use of hypersonic missiles in the bombing of Ukraine in the last hours. These are the Russian-made Kinzhal ballistic rockets, developed since 2010 and entered into service in experimental form in 2018 as part of Moscow's aerospace forces.

Harsh retort of US President Joe Biden: "With the same warheads used on the other missiles do not make much difference, except for the fact that it is almost impossible to intercept them", reports the American television station "CNN"; of the same opinion the intelligence of the United Kingdom. 

"Attacks with this system of air-to-ground missiles against Ukrainian military infrastructure will continue during the special military operation", said the spokesman for the Russian Defense Ministry, Igor Konashenkov, pointing out that twice in recent days they have resorted to this type of missiles capable of evading enemy anti-missile defense systems. 

The Russian Kh-47M2 Kinzhal hypersonic rocket was successfully tested for the first time in 2018. It is capable of reaching a speed of up to Mach 10 and targets located at a distance of up to 1000-2000 km when launched from fixed positions, but it can also be fired from military aircraft, particularly Mig-31 fighters.
